    I love the scooter and the box it comes in is not freakishly large. I think it would easily fit into an average closet, possibly even on the top shelf. I just threw the box away or I would try it for you. I can tell you that I was pleasantly surprised at the size and quality of the scooter. We had one of those Target ones once and finally offed it because it was so big. Jess's scooter is much nicer quality and more compact. It is also very, very cute!     I have Jess and her collection and I love it! I usually do not go into geting whole collections etc., but the playability of hers' is spectacular!

    Whe I saw the scooter is Jeanette's "Biker Chic" album, I knew it was a "must have" for me. That scooter is so cool! It comes with a helmet, and storage on the back of the scooter that can hold things and seat another dollie too! It has three buttons. One is a horn, another makes a roaring motor sound when depressed, and the third is the light which turns it self off after a few seconds! It is super cool and I have much fun with it!!!
